Photo Flash: THE LOST YEARS Opens Tomorrow at Contra Costa Civic Theatre

By: Apr. 06, 2017

Mistaken identities, family secrets, artistic ambitions, and terrible puns set the stage for Contra Costa Civic Theatre's world premiere production of The Lost Years by Los Angeles-based playwright Cynthia Wands, from April 7-30. The production, directed by CCCT Artistic Director Marilyn Langbehn, marks only the second world premiere in the company's 57-year history. CCCT's production of The Lost Years features Shannon Warrick (TBA nominee for August: Osage County) as Nona; Ben Knoll (seen earlier this season in Well) as Humphrey Bludgepot; Mikkel Simons (Sr. James in CCCT's Doubt) as the bride, Isabelle; Mark Albi (Anna in the Tropics, Ross Valley Players) as Richard Burbage; Sandi Weldon (most recently seen as the Grand Duchess Olga Katrina in CCCT's You Can't Take it With You) as Lady Catherine Thomas; and Stephanie Goodman (I Hate Hamlet at Pacifica Spindrift Players) as the maid, Helena.
